内容简介
Mearly
20
YEARS
AFTER
MAKING
THE
world's
most
famous
underwater
discovery,Robert
D.Ballard
retruns
to
Titanic
to
record
the
most
dramatic
images
of
the
wreek
yet
seen-and
to
expose
evidence
of
new
dangers
that
impericl
the
legndary
ship.
As
Ballard
prepares
for
the
expedition,he
takes
us
back
to
the
clear,starry
night
of
April
14,1912,when
tons
of
icy
water
inundated
the
huge
vessel
and
dragged
it
and
1,523
souls
to
a
deep-sea
grave.He
explores
the
natrual
events
and
human
mis-judgments
that
eld
to
catastrophe,the
drama
that
contributes
to
the
mythology,and
the
people
who
make
Titanic's
story
live
on,from
confident
Captain
E.J.Smith,who
perished
with
the
ship
eh
ardently
proclaimed
safe,to
a
retired
London
justice
of
the
peace
who
recalled
playing
with
her
teddy
bear
on
Titanic's
sunny
decks-then
pulling
away
in
a
lifeboat,leaving
her
father
on
the
dying
vessel.
Ballard
chronicles
early
attempts
to
find
Titanic,including
a
1953
mission
using
echolocation,a
precuror
to
the
sonar
imaging
of
today.Then,as
he
and
his
team
return
to
the
site
in
May
2004,Ballard
briefs
us
on
the
"million-dollar
video
game"of
Titanic's
prow…of
artifacts
that
con-jure
scenes
of
human
pathos…of
changes
carsed
by
natural
edterioration
and
by
humans
salvagers:Countless
artifacts
have
been
taken,submersible
tracks
crisscross
the
site,and
new
damage
reveals:Countless
artifacts
have
been
taken,submersible
tracks
crisscross
the
site,and
new
damage
reveals
where
manned
mini
subs
have
parked
on
Titanic
to
give
passengers
a
better
view.
